Promoting Safe Hodgdon CFE223 Reloading Practices
When working with Hodgdon CFE223 powder for assembling ammunition, unwavering care to safe techniques is paramount. Always review the latest Hodgdon Ammunition Manual – it’s your primary guide for accurate load data. Never exceed the maximum listed amounts in the manual. Utilize a quality powder scale, calibrated regularly, to ensure consistent powder measurement. Thoroughly measure bullet capacity, as this can vary significantly based on maker and condition. Avoid mixing different gunpowders – this is exceptionally risky. Store CFE223 in a cool, dry place, away from heat and ignition sources, in a secure container. Remember, responsible reloading practices safeguard both you and others; never compromise safety in the pursuit of performance.
